1.10 Description of labels and symbols
Labels on the outside of the machine
Cab eye hook label
The eye hooks on the cab are for removing the cab only and may not be used for crane
handling the machine – see chapter 3 “Crane handling the machine” on page 3-59 for fur-
ther details.
Location
Cab roof (4x).
Label for loading and tying down the machine
Eye hooks for tying down the machine B during transport, and eye hooks A for loading the
machine.
➥ – see chapter 3 “Crane handling the machine” on page 3-59
➥ – see chapter 3 “Loading and transporting the machine on a transport vehicle” on
page 3-60
Location
On left and right of machine frame above the front axle attachment and at the rear under
the machine.
Noise level label
Noise levels produced by the machine.
➥ L
WA
= sound power level – see chapter 6 “Noise levels” on page 6-12
Location
On the rear window.
Label: maximum design-specific speed
Design-specific max. machine speed 20 kph (30/40 kph option)
Location
At the rear of the machine and on the left/right of the counterweight.
Label: general indication of danger
This label warns persons standing or working near the machine of an existing danger
within the area of increased danger around the machine.
Location
Front left and right of loader unit, and at rear of machine.
